What skills and experience we're looking for
We have an exciting opportunity for a new Headteacher to lead St Helen’s C of E School, located just outside of Bideford, as it transfers into the Learning Academy Partnership from Alumnis Multi-Academy Trust. It is an exciting time for the school but also one of change for children, colleagues, parents and the community. This is a joint recruitment with Alumnis as the school will be transferring between Trusts in the summer term.
We are offering a £5,000 relocation package for candidates relocating from outside Devon or Cornwall.
St Helen’s is in a period of change, and we are seeking a Headteacher who can manage not only the change for the parents, children and colleagues but also ensure a strong curriculum offer delivering inclusive practice, effective pedagogical practice and outcomes in place, and that it unashamedly privileges the most underserved children.
The Learning Academy Partnership is driven by mission and beliefs ensuring that every child has the right to live life to the full. We are committed to improving educational outcomes for underserved children across the South-West and breaking down barriers to social mobility. Our Headteachers achieve this through a rich, vibrant curriculum delivered by excellent teachers.
You will be joining a strong, single organisation, culture of collective efficacy and one that is rooted in our Christian foundation. We are passionate about our role in social justice in our communities and tackling stubborn South West deprivation.
As a Church School leader, you will uphold and develop the school’s Christian distinctiveness through its educational offer. We welcome applicants with or without prior experience of leading a Church school. We offer full induction and support as you embark on a journey as a church school leader.

We are an inclusive School Trust where everything begins and ends with the children. We want to ensure that we have a profound impact on the future lives of our children so that they have choices and options which will enable them to flourish as they go through life. Quite simply, we put children first in all that we do.
We are committed to social mobility by working together as a single School Trust with a shared responsibility for all children, no matter which school they attend, including Church and community schools.
We invest in people, enabling them to flourish and ensure that every child is taught by a great teacher. Our wellbeing strategy enables us to nurture, develop and care for our colleagues so that they can provide the very best for our children
We want every child to experience an excellent curriculum which is distinctive to their community and create environments where they are cared for, inspired, challenged, and develop a love of learning.
We care passionately about children outside of our School Trust as well. We collaborate and work with other schools and School Trusts as well as being a National English Hub that specialises in early reading and phonics.
